Jetta L4-2.0L (BEV) (2004)
Transmission Position Switch/Sensor: Testing and Inspection
Multi-Function Transmission Range (TR) Switch, Checking
Recommended special tools and equipment
-
V.A.G 1526 multimeter or V.A.G 1715 multimeter
-
V.A.G 1594 connector test kit
-
Wiring diagram
Requirements
-
Respective fuses must be OK.
-
Instrument cluster control module -J285- must be OK.
-
Selector lever must be in -P- position.
-
Ground (GND) connections to transmission must be OK.
-
All electrical consumers such as, lights and rear window defroster must be switched off.
-
Parking brake must be engaged.
-
Ignition switched off.
Function test
-
Switch ignition on.
-
Depress brake pedal and maintain depressed.
-
Shift into all selector lever positions.
NOTE: Selector lever position must correspond to display of Instrument cluster control module -J285-.
-
Switch ignition off.
If selector lever position does not correspond to display of Instrument cluster control module -J285-:
-
Disconnect connector from Multi-Function Transmission Range (TR) switch -F125-.
Observe safety precautions.
-
Check harness connector for contact corrosion and ingress of water.
If harness connector is not OK:
-
Repair malfunction and repeat test sequence.
-
